+7 (499) 288-06-73

Скопировать

Разработка мобильных игр с искусственным интеллектом на android

Разработка мобильных игр с искусственным интеллектом на android

Время чтения: 3 минут
Просмотров: 1231

Искусственный интеллект становится все более значимым в различных сферах нашей жизни, включая развлекательную индустрию. Разработка мобильных игр с использованием искусственного интеллекта становится все популярнее.

Android, как одна из самых популярных операционных систем для мобильных устройств, предоставляет удобный инструментарий для создания игр с использованием искусственного интеллекта. Разработчики имеют доступ к различным библиотекам и инструментам для реализации алгоритмов ИИ в своих проектах.

Игры с искусственным интеллектом на android открывают новые возможности для геймеров, создавая увлекательные и умные игровые миры. Разработчики могут использовать ИИ для создания непредсказуемой игровой среды и улучшения опыта игроков.

Разработка мобильных игр с искусственным интеллектом на Android открывает перед разработчиками широкие возможности для создания увлекательных и инновационных проектов. Одна из основных целей использования искусственного интеллекта в мобильных играх - улучшение их геймплея путем создания более умных и адаптивных противников, помощников или систем управления.

Преимущества разработки мобильных игр с искусственным интеллектом на Android:

  • Улучшенный геймплей: Повышение уровня сложности искусственного интеллекта противников делает игру более интересной и захватывающей для игроков.
  • Повышение уровня реализма: Использование искусственного интеллекта позволяет создавать более реалистичные игровые миры с непредсказуемыми сценариями поведения персонажей.
  • Улучшенная адаптивность: Искусственный интеллект способен адаптироваться к стилю игры каждого конкретного игрока, делая процесс игры более персонализированным.
  • Создание умных помощников: ИИ может быть использован для создания умных аватаров или ботов, помогающих игрокам в решении сложных задач или поддержании интереса к игре.

Технологии, используемые при разработке мобильных игр с искусственным интеллектом на Android:

  • Машинное обучение: Алгоритмы машинного обучения позволяют создавать противников и персонажей, которые могут самостоятельно учиться и принимать решения на основе полученного опыта.
  • Нейронные сети: Использование нейронных сетей позволяет создавать более сложные и реалистичные модели поведения персонажей, а также предсказывать действия игроков.
  • Генетические алгоритмы: Генетические алгоритмы применяются для оптимизации поведения персонажей и поиска наилучших стратегий в игровом мире.

Ключевые моменты при создании мобильных игр с искусственным интеллектом на Android:

  • Изучение рынка: Прежде чем начинать разработку, необходимо изучить предпочтения и потребности целевой аудитории, чтобы создать игру, которая будет популярной.
  • Оптимизация производительности: Использование искусственного интеллекта может быть ресурсоемким процессом, поэтому важно оптимизировать производительность игры для различных устройств.
  • Тестирование: Проведение тестирования игры с искусственным интеллектом поможет выявить и исправить возможные ошибки и улучшить взаимодействие персонажей.

В заключение можно сказать, что разработка мобильных игр с искусственным интеллектом на Android представляет собой увлекательный и перспективный процесс, который требует как технических знаний, так и креативного подхода к созданию игрового контента. Использование искусственного интеллекта не только делает игру более интересной для игроков, но и открывает новые возможности для индустрии мобильных игр в целом.

Ключ к созданию успешной мобильной игры с искусственным интеллектом на платформе Android - это постоянное стремление к инновациям и улучшениям.

Илон Маск

Название игры Описание Технологии
AI Dungeon Интерактивная текстовая игра с использованием искусственного интеллекта OpenAI GPT-3
Replika Симулятор общения с виртуальным собеседником на основе нейронных сетей Нейронные сети
Camfrog Мобильный чат с использованием технологий искусственного интеллекта Компьютерное зрение
Clash of Clans Стратегия с элементами искусственного интеллекта для управления воинами Машинное обучение
Siri Голосовой помощник с использованием технологий искусственного интеллекта Голосовые алгоритмы
Pokemon Go AR-игра с элементами искусственного интеллекта для управления покемонами Компьютерное зрение и машинное обучение

Основные проблемы по теме "Разработка мобильных игр с искусственным интеллектом на android"

Отсутствие оптимизации для различных устройств

Первой проблемой при разработке мобильных игр с искусственным интеллектом на android является отсутствие оптимизации под различные устройства. Игры должны работать плавно на разных моделях телефонов и планшетов, требуя разной мощности от устройств. Необходимо учитывать разные характеристики устройств и производить оптимизацию кода для обеспечения оптимальной производительности игры на всех устройствах.

Сложности интеграции с платформой android

Второй проблемой являются сложности интеграции разработанной игры с платформой android. Необходимо учитывать специфику операционной системы, требования Google Play Store к приложениям, правила использования ресурсов устройства. Интеграция с различными сервисами, такими как рекламные сети или аналитика, также может представлять сложность и требовать дополнительных манипуляций.

Недостаточная поддержка библиотек и инструментов

Третьей проблемой является недостаточная поддержка библиотек и инструментов для разработки мобильных игр с искусственным интеллектом на android. Некоторые библиотеки или инструменты могут быть несовместимы с android, иметь ограничения по использованию на мобильных устройствах или не обновляться для поддержки последних версий операционной системы. Разработчики могут столкнуться с ограничениями в функционале или производительности из-за недостатка подходящих инструментов.

Какие технологии и инструменты используются при разработке мобильных игр с искусственным интеллектом на android?

Для разработки мобильных игр с искусственным интеллектом на android часто используются такие технологии как Java, Kotlin, Unity, Unreal Engine. Для работы с искусственным интеллектом могут применяться различные фреймворки и библиотеки, такие как TensorFlow или OpenCV.

Какие задачи может решать искусственный интеллект в мобильных играх на android?

Искусственный интеллект в мобильных играх на android может решать различные задачи, включая оптимизацию поведения неписей, создание интеллектуальных соперников, анализ игровой ситуации, адаптацию сложности игры под уровень навыков игрока и другие.

Как повысить интересность и динамичность мобильной игры с искусственным интеллектом на android?

Для повышения интересности и динамичности мобильной игры с искусственным интеллектом на android можно использовать разнообразные алгоритмы искусственного интеллекта, создавать уникальных персонажей с различным поведением, интегрировать возможности многопользовательской игры через интернет и внедрять системы адаптации под стиль игры конкретного игрока.

Материал подготовлен командой app-android.ru

Читать ещё

Как подключить геймпад к Айфону
В этой статье мы расскажем, как настроить геймпад на айфоне за пару минут, и ответим на возможные вопросы.
Приложения для диагностики Android
При покупке телефона у многих пользователей возникает интерес: «Насколько мощно работает гаджет?»
Применение принципов Continuous Integration (CI) и Continuous Deployment (CD) в Android-разработке
Современная разработка под Android